Comprehending Tilt and Turn Windows

Tilt and turn windows are designed with an unique mechanism that enables users to open the window in two ways: tilting it inward for ventilation or fully turning it open for optimal access. This dual functionality makes them an attractive option for numerous house owners. Nevertheless, the elaborate equipment included can often cause repair requirements.

Typical Issues Requiring Repair

Tilt and turn windows, like all windows, can experience issues with time. Here are some typical issues that may need interior repair:

  1. Sticking Mechanism: The window may not open or close efficiently due to dirt accumulation or misalignment.
  2. Weather Condition Stripping Wear: Over time, sealing strips can wear down, causing drafts and decreased energy performance.
  3. Broken Handles: The deals with can end up being loose or break, making it difficult to operate the window.
  4. Glass Issues: Cracks or chips in the glass can take place, causing potential security risks and reduced insulation.
  5. Mechanical Failure: The internal hardware can malfunction, avoiding the window from functioning properly.

DIY Repair Techniques

Lots of small repair work can be tackled by property owners. Here's  Repair My Windows And Doors -by-step guide to some common DIY repairs for tilt and turn windows.

Action 1: Inspect the Window

Before starting any repair, conduct a thorough inspection of the window. Look for the following:

  • Alignment and functionality of the hinges
  • Condition of the weather removing
  • Performance of deals with
  • Any damage to the glass or frame

Step 2: Address Sticking Mechanisms

  1. Tidy the Hinges: Use a soft brush or vacuum to get rid of dirt and debris. Use a silicone-based lubricant to guarantee smooth movement.
  2. Realign the Window: If the window is misaligned, change the hinges according to the manufacturer's directions.

Action 3: Replace Weather Stripping

  1. Eliminate Old Stripping: Gently pry off the worn weather condition stripping.
  2. Cut New Stripping: Measure and cut the brand-new weather condition removing to size.
  3. Set Up New Stripping: Press the new removing into place, making sure a tight seal.

Step 4: Fix or Replace Handles

  1. Tighten Up Loose Handles: Use a screwdriver to tighten up any loose screws.
  2. Change Broken Handles: Follow the maker's directions to remove the old handle and set up a new one.

Step 5: Repair Glass Issues

  1. Small Cracks: Use a glass repair package to complete small fractures following the package guidelines.
  2. Replacement: For bigger fractures or damage, think about working with a professional glazier to change the glass.

When to Call a Professional

While numerous repair work can be done separately, some issues need the knowledge of a professional. You ought to consult a specialist if:

  • The window's internal mechanism is harmed or malfunctioning beyond easy repair work.
  • The glass is shattered or badly broken.
  • You need replacement parts that are particular to the window design.
  • There are structural issues with the window frame.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: How often should tilt and turn windows be kept?

Routine maintenance, such as cleaning and lubrication of the hardware, ought to be done a minimum of once a year. Weather stripping might need replacing every couple of years.

Q2: Can I change the entire window myself?

Changing an entire window can be complex and usually needs professional installation to ensure appropriate sealing and insulation.

Q3: What kind of lube should I utilize?

A silicone-based lubricant is suggested for the mechanisms of tilt and turn windows, as it will not draw in dirt or dust.

Q4: How can I enhance the energy performance of my tilt and turn windows?

Frequently check and change weather condition stripping, ensure hinges are tidy and working, and consider setting up thermal drapes or blinds.

Q5: Is it worth repairing older tilt and turn windows?

If the structure and mechanism are sound, it might be more economical to repair than to change, particularly if they use terrific energy effectiveness and aesthetics.
